Ginger (Zingiber officinale): Known in Sanskrit as 'adrak', ginger is a powerhouse for digestive health. It effectively stimulates digestive enzymes, offering relief from nausea and reducing inflammation. Enjoy ginger as a soothing tea, incorporate it into your meals, or combine powdered ginger with honey for a potent remedy. This powerful root is one of the most versatile ayurvedic herbs for digestion. 2. Triphala: A classic Ayurvedic formulation, Triphala blends three powerful fruits: Amalaki, Bibhitaki, and Haritaki. Renowned for its detoxifying properties, Triphala gently cleanses the body and enhances gut health. Taking a teaspoon of Triphala powder mixed in warm water before bed can regulate bowel movements and improve overall digestive function. Peppermint (Mentha piperita): This refreshing herb, known as 'pudina', offers a soothing effect on the digestive tract, alleviating symptoms of irritable bowel syndrome. Enjoy peppermint tea as a calming post-meal beverage. Peppermint is a calming choice among ayurvedic herbs for digestion. 5. Cumin Seeds (Cuminum cyminum): Cumin, or 'jeera', is a warming herb that supports digestion and enhances the absorption of nutrients. Add it to your dishes or steep it in hot water to create a comforting tea. Cumin is a flavorful choice among ayurvedic herbs for digestion. 6. Turmeric (Curcuma longa): Revered as a golden spice, turmeric possesses potent anti-inflammatory properties, supporting liver health and digestion. Incorporating turmeric into your cooking or taking it as a supplement can significantly boost digestive function. Turmeric is a vibrant addition to your collection of ayurvedic herbs for digestion. - Pitta Dosha: Pitta individuals often struggle with acidity and inflammation. Cooling herbs, such as peppermint and coriander, are ideal for soothing Pitta's fiery nature. Enjoy herbal teas made with these ingredients to balance your digestive fire without overheating your system. Cooling herbs are the best way to address inflammation by using ayurvedic herbs for digestion.
- Kapha Dosha: Those with a Kapha constitution may experience sluggish digestion. Warming herbs like cumin and ginger stimulate digestion and clear excess mucus. Incorporating spicy foods can invigorate the Kapha system, promoting optimal digestive health.
